Atom Z515

The Atom Z515 is manufactured by Intel. It was released in 8 April 2009 (16 years ago). It is based on the Silverthorne (2008−2010) architecture. It features 1 cores and 1 threads. Base frequency is 1.2 GHz, with boost up to 1.2 GHz. L3 cache: 0 kB. L2 cache: 512 kB (per core). Built on 45 nm process technology. Socket: PBGA441. Thermal design power (TDP): 1.4 Watt. Memory support: unknown. Passmark benchmark score: 195 points. Launch price was $69.

Memory & Platform

Both processors use the PBGA441 socket with PCIe 2.0. Both support up to DDR2-533 memory speed. Both support up to 2 GB of RAM. Both feature 1-channel memory with ECC support. Both provide 0 PCIe lanes. Chipset compatibility: Intel US15W (Atom Z520) and Intel US15W (Atom Z515).
